Abstract

The embodiment of the invention discloses an intelligent home control method, device and system and an intelligent gateway, and relates to the technical field of intelligent home. The intelligent household control method comprises the following steps: acquiring user instruction information, wherein the user instruction information comprises control information for controlling the target intelligent household appliance and target position information for representing the position of the target intelligent household appliance; determining whether the target position information is matched with the position of the current intelligent gateway; and when the target position information is not matched with the position of the current intelligent gateway, sending control information to the target intelligent gateway with the position matched with the target position information, wherein the control information is used for controlling the target intelligent household electrical appliance to execute corresponding operation by the target intelligent gateway. Through the interconnection between the intelligent gateway and the intelligent household electrical appliance in different scenes, the cross-scene control of the intelligent household electrical appliance is realized, and a quick and convenient automatic operation experience is provided for a user.

In recent years, with the improvement of technical levels in the fields of computer technology, automation control and the like, intelligent household appliances gradually enter the daily life of people, so that the life of people is more convenient and comfortable, and people refer to intelligent homes (smart homes).
In an intelligent home, various intelligent home appliances in a room can control the working state of the intelligent home appliances through a main controller, and the main controller is called an intelligent gateway. The intelligent gateway plays a role of an intelligent home control hub, and can realize functions of system information acquisition, information input, information output, centralized control, linkage control and the like.
However, in the current smart home, on one hand, due to the limitations of circuit wiring and signal transmission distance, in some large-area indoor environments, the same smart gateway cannot establish connection with the smart home devices in all the positions of all rooms in the environment; on the other hand, because the operation of the user depends on the intelligent gateway, the user wants to control each intelligent household appliance through the intelligent gateway, and generally needs to directly operate on the intelligent gateway, but the position of the intelligent gateway is not nearest to the client under any circumstances, so that when the user needs to control the intelligent household appliance in a room far away from the intelligent gateway, the intelligent control cannot be rapidly performed through the intelligent gateway, and the use efficiency of the intelligent gateway is low, and the operation is inconvenient.
In order to solve the problems, the inventor provides an intelligent home control method, an intelligent home control device, an intelligent home control system and an intelligent gateway in the embodiment of the invention through long-term research, cross-scene control of intelligent home devices is realized by interconnecting the intelligent gateways and the intelligent home devices in different scenes, the use efficiency of the intelligent gateways is improved, and quick and convenient automatic operation experience is provided for users.

Referring to fig. 1, fig. 1 is a schematic structural diagram of an intelligent gateway 100 according to an embodiment of the present invention.
Referring to fig. 2, fig. 2 is a block diagram of an intelligent gateway 100 provided in this embodiment.
As shown in fig. 1 and fig. 2, in the present embodiment, the intelligent gateway 100 includes a main body 11, a display 12, a key assembly 13, a voice interaction recognition module 14, a control module 15, and a communication module 16. As shown in fig. 1, display 12 and key unit 13 are provided in main body 11, and a user can directly see a screen of display 12 and physical keys of key unit 13, which are provided in parallel outside main body 11, from outside main body 11. As a way, in order to keep the overall external appearance of the intelligent gateway 100 beautiful, the voice interaction recognition module 14, the control module 15 and the communication module 16 are all disposed inside the main body 11 (not shown in fig. 1), it is understood that in other possible embodiments, the voice interaction recognition module 14, the control module 15 and the communication module 16 may also be partially or completely disposed outside the main body 11.
Further, in some embodiments, when the display 12 is a touch screen, the key assembly 13 may include a touch assembly disposed in the main body 11 and overlapped with the screen of the display 12, in addition to the physical keys disposed outside the main body 11, and the touch assembly and the physical keys may implement the same or different functions. It is understood that the number of the key assemblies 13 and the corresponding functions may be any, and may be automatically configured according to different application scenarios or may be set by a user through customization, and the embodiment is not limited herein.
In this embodiment, as shown in fig. 2, the control module 15 is connected to the display 12, the key assembly 13, the voice interaction recognition module 14, and the communication module 16, respectively.
In some embodiments, the key assembly 13 may be configured to collect user operation information of a preset key (which may be a physical key or a virtual key displayed on a touch screen) acting on the control module 15, and send the user operation information to the control module; the voice interaction recognition module 14 may be configured to collect user voice information of a current scene, and send the user voice information to the control module 15; the control module 15 may be configured to generate corresponding control information according to the user operation information and/or the user voice information; the communication module 16 may be used to establish communication connections between different intelligent gateways 100 and between the intelligent gateway 100 and the intelligent home devices 17.
Further, in some embodiments, the voice interaction recognition module 14 may include a voice recognition component and a voice interaction component. The voice recognition component can collect user voice information through a microphone and recognize control information corresponding to user requirements from the user voice information; the voice interaction component may interact with the user through a speaker in a manner that plays voice.
In some embodiments, the communication module 16 may establish a communication connection with other devices through various wired communication modes, such as power line communication, fiber communication, internet, coaxial cable or telephone line, or wireless communication modes, such as infrared communication, bluetooth communication, Zwave, NFC, ZigBee, WiFi, and the like.
In some embodiments, the intelligent gateways 100 may also perform data transmission and sharing through a connection server, and each intelligent home device 17 may also be connected to the server, so that the intelligent gateways 100 can monitor the operating state of each intelligent home device 17 in each scene in real time.
Referring to fig. 3, fig. 3 is a scene schematic diagram of the smart home control system 10 according to the embodiment.
In this embodiment, as shown in fig. 3, the smart home control system 10 includes a plurality of smart gateways 100 provided in this embodiment and a plurality of smart home devices 17. The intelligent gateways 100 are distributed in different scenes, and the intelligent gateways 100 are in communication connection; the plurality of intelligent home devices 17 are disposed in the same scene or different scenes, and as a mode, each intelligent gateway 100 is in communication connection with at least the plurality of intelligent home devices 17 in the same scene.
In this embodiment, a scene may refer to a control area associated with the intelligent gateway 100, and the control area may be continuous in physical space without being divided (for example, in the same room), or may be spaced apart in physical space (when the intelligent home devices 17 in multiple rooms are controlled by the same intelligent gateway 100, the multiple rooms may be regarded as one scene).
In some embodiments, the intelligent gateway 100 may be configured to collect user instruction information and control the target intelligent home devices 17 in the corresponding target scene to perform corresponding operations according to the collected user instruction information.
In the intelligent home control system 10 provided in this embodiment, because the intelligent gateways 100 in different scenes are in communication connection with each other, the intelligent gateway 100 in a certain scene can not only control the intelligent household appliances 17 in the same scene, but also send control information to the intelligent gateways 100 in other scenes through the communication module 16, and control the intelligent household appliances 17 in other scenes through other intelligent gateways 100, thereby realizing cross-scene control of the intelligent household appliances 17, improving the interactivity of the intelligent home and the use efficiency of the intelligent gateway 100, and providing a quick and convenient automated operation experience for users.
Referring to fig. 4, fig. 4 is a schematic flow chart of a smart home control method according to an embodiment of the present invention. The intelligent home control method provided by the embodiment is suitable for the intelligent home control system provided by the embodiment.
Step S101: and collecting user instruction information.
In this embodiment, the user instruction information may include control information for controlling the target intelligent home appliance and target location information for indicating a location of the target intelligent home appliance.
As a mode, user instruction information can be acquired through screen touch detection, physical key detection, voice recognition or the like of the intelligent gateway, and the user instruction information can be used for representing the control requirement of a user on the intelligent household appliance. The target smart home device may be a smart home device that the user wants to control.
As a specific implementation scenario, for example, a user wants to turn off an air conditioner in room B in room a, at this time, the user may say "turn off the air conditioner in room B", at this time, an intelligent gateway installed in room a may collect a voice of the user "turn off the air conditioner in room B" through a voice interaction recognition module and recognize the voice to generate corresponding user instruction information, where the user instruction information may include control information for controlling a target intelligent household appliance "air conditioner in room B" to perform "turn off" operation, and target location information indicating a location "room B" where the target intelligent household appliance "air conditioner in room B" is located.
Step S102: and determining whether the target position information is matched with the position of the current intelligent gateway.
In this embodiment, the current intelligent gateway may be an intelligent gateway that collects user instruction information. The target intelligent household electrical appliance as the user instruction information object may be in the same current scene (area and room controlled by the current intelligent gateway) as the position of the user (or the current intelligent gateway) or in other scenes different from the position of the user.
It can be understood that at least one intelligent gateway is arranged in each scene, and a user can control the intelligent household appliances in a target scene (current scene or other scenes) through the current intelligent gateway in the current scene.
In this embodiment, whether the target location information is matched with the location of the current intelligent gateway may refer to whether a scene (target scene) corresponding to the location (target location) of the target intelligent home appliance is a scene (or area) where the current intelligent gateway is located (or controlled).
In this embodiment, if the scene corresponding to the location of the target intelligent household appliance is the current scene in which the current intelligent gateway is located, it may be considered that the target location information matches the current scene in which the current intelligent gateway is located, and at this time, the target intelligent household appliance in the same scene may be directly controlled by the current intelligent gateway in the current scene to execute the operation corresponding to the control information (for example, turn off the electric lamp in the current room); if the scene corresponding to the location of the target intelligent household electrical appliance is another scene different from the current scene where the current intelligent gateway is located, it may be considered that the target location information is not matched with the current scene where the current intelligent gateway is located, and step S103 may be executed at this time.
Step S103: and sending the control information to a target intelligent gateway matched with the target position information.
In this embodiment, when the target location information is not matched with the current scene where the current intelligent gateway is located, the current intelligent gateway that collects the user instruction information in the current scene may send the control information in the collected user instruction information to the target intelligent gateway in the target scene (the scene corresponding to the target intelligent household electrical appliance) matched with the target location information. When the target intelligent gateway receives the control information which is sent by the current intelligent gateway of the current scene and used for controlling the target intelligent household appliances in the target scene, the target intelligent household appliances can be controlled to execute corresponding operations according to the control information.
As a specific implementation scenario, for example, when the user command information collected by the intelligent gateway K1 installed in the room a includes control information for controlling the target intelligent household electrical appliance "B room air conditioner" to perform the "off" operation and target location information indicating the location "B room" where the target intelligent household electrical appliance "B room air conditioner" is located, the intelligent gateway K1 in the room a may send the control information for controlling the target intelligent household electrical appliance "B room air conditioner" to perform the "off" operation to the intelligent gateway K2 installed in the room B; after receiving the control information sent by the intelligent gateway K1, the intelligent gateway K2 may control the target intelligent home appliance "room B air conditioner" located in the target scene "room B" to perform a shutdown operation according to the control information.
It can be understood that if a plurality of intelligent household appliances of the same type exist in the same scene, for example, a wall-mounted air conditioner B1 and a cabinet air conditioner B2 are respectively disposed at different positions in the B room, if the user instruction acquired by the intelligent gateway is only "turn off the air conditioner in the B room", the air conditioner B1 and the air conditioner B2 in the B room can be simultaneously used as target intelligent household appliances, and the turning-off operation is simultaneously performed.
As a possible mode, the intelligent gateway can also recognize the voice command of the user according to the habit and the preference of the user. For example, when the voice command of the user is only "close the air conditioner in the B room", the conventional habitual operation of the user is to close the wall air conditioner B1 in the B room only, and the cabinet air conditioner B2 is kept on, at this time, the intelligent gateway may generate control information for closing the wall air conditioner B1 only according to the habit or preference of the user, that is, only the wall air conditioner B1 is used as the target intelligent household appliance, so as to implement more intelligent household control.
According to the intelligent home control method provided by the embodiment, the intelligent gateways and the intelligent household appliances in different scenes are interconnected, so that cross-scene control over the intelligent household appliances is realized, the use efficiency of the intelligent gateways is improved, and quick and convenient automatic operation experience is provided for users.
Referring to fig. 5, fig. 5 is a schematic flow chart of a smart home control method according to another embodiment of the present invention. The intelligent home control method provided by the embodiment is suitable for the intelligent home control system provided by the embodiment.
In this embodiment, the step of collecting the user instruction information may be divided into step S201 and step S202 according to different collecting modes, and the step S201 and the step S202 are collected through a key assembly (a physical key of an intelligent gateway or a virtual key on a touch screen); and/or step S203, step S204 and step S205 are collected through a voice interaction recognition module.
Step S201: and collecting user operation information acting on the preset keys.
In this embodiment, the preset key may be a physical key on the control panel of the intelligent gateway, or may be a virtual key displayed on the display screen of the touch screen, and the preset key is preset to correspond to at least one user instruction information.
In some embodiments, the user instruction information corresponding to the preset key may be set by a user in a self-defined manner, or may be configured intelligently and dynamically by the intelligent gateway according to the use habit or preference of the user, or may be configured in advance by different applications running in the intelligent gateway system (that is, when different applications are running, the function corresponding to the preset key may be different).
As a mode, the collection of user operation information can be used for collecting the operation of a user through sensor modules such as a pressure sensor and a heat-sensitive sensor in a key assembly.
Step S202: and generating user instruction information corresponding to the preset key function of the intelligent gateway according to the user operation information.
In this embodiment, when the intelligent gateway detects an operation such as a click or a gesture triggered by a user through a physical key or a touch screen, corresponding user instruction information may be generated according to a preset key function corresponding to the key.
As a specific implementation scenario, for example, the smart gateway includes a plurality of physical keys or virtual keys corresponding to different or same functions, such as the key P1, the key P2, and the key P3, and when the user taps the key P1, the smart gateway may generate user instruction information corresponding to a preset key function of the key P1, where the user instruction information may include control information for controlling the lamp in the room a to be turned on, and target location information for indicating a location where the lamp in the room a is located.
Step S203: and collecting the voice information of the user.
In this embodiment, the intelligent gateway may collect the user voice information in the current scene through the voice interaction recognition module, that is, obtain the voice instruction sent by the user in the current scene. It will be appreciated that in some possible embodiments, the intelligent gateway may also collect voice commands issued by users located in other scenarios.
As a mode, the voice interaction recognition module of the intelligent gateway has a preset pickup range, and when the distance between a user and the intelligent gateway is within the pickup range, a voice instruction (user voice information) given by the user can be acquired by the intelligent gateway. As one way, the sound pickup range can be set by a user, and the sound pickup ranges of the intelligent gateways in different scenes can be the same or different.
As a mode, in order to avoid mistakenly collecting user voice information in other scenes, the voice interaction recognition module may further have a preset pickup power threshold, and when the power of a voice instruction sent by a user is higher than the pickup power threshold, the voice instruction is used as the user voice information of the current scene.
Step S204: and recognizing the voice information of the user, and acquiring the identity information of the target intelligent household appliance corresponding to the voice information of the user and control information for controlling the target intelligent household appliance.
In this embodiment, as a manner, each intelligent household electrical appliance in each scene corresponds to a unique identity information, and the identity information may be used as an identity of the intelligent household electrical appliance. For example, the identity information of the wall-mounted air conditioner B1 in the room B may be composed of the room "B" where the intelligent household electrical appliance is located and the number "1".
The user voice information is usually natural language information, and the natural language information can be identified through a voice interaction identification module, and identity information of the intelligent household appliance and control operation (control information) required to be executed on the intelligent household appliance, which are contained in the natural language information, are analyzed.
As one approach, a plurality of scenes (rooms, areas) within a home environment may be numbered in advance. For example, when the living room is numbered a, the master bedroom is numbered B, the secondary bedroom is numbered C, and the kitchen is numbered D, when the user voice information is "close the wall-hung air conditioner in the master bedroom", the user voice information is analyzed by the voice interaction identification module, and then the corresponding identity information "B1" of the wall-hung air conditioner and control information for controlling "B1" to execute the closing operation can be generated.
Step S205: and acquiring target position information for representing the position of the target intelligent household appliance according to the identity information.
In this embodiment, after the identity information of the target intelligent household appliance is obtained, the target location information corresponding to the identity information may be queried in a pre-established comparison table of the identity information and the location information, where the comparison table may be stored in a local memory of the intelligent gateway or in a server, so that the intelligent gateway is obtained by connecting to the server.
For example, the table of the identity information and the location information may be as shown in table 1:
TABLE 1
Intelligent household electrical appliance Scene Identity information Location information
Television A1 Parlor A1 A
Window curtain A2 Parlor A2 A
Wall hanging type air conditioner B1 Master bedroom B1 B
Cabinet air conditioner B2 Master bedroom B2 B
Curtain C1 Secondary bedroom C1 C
It should be understood that the naming rules and the corresponding relationships of the identity information and the location information may be arbitrary, and table 1 is only used for example and is not limited herein.
In this embodiment, after the user instruction information is collected, step S206 may be executed.
Step S206: and judging whether the target position information is matched with the current scene where the current intelligent gateway is located.
In this embodiment, when the target location information does not match the current scene where the current intelligent gateway is located, step S207 and step S208 may be executed.
Step S207: and acquiring the state information of the target intelligent household appliance from the target intelligent gateway in the target scene matched with the target position information.
In this embodiment, if the current intelligent gateway detects that the target scene corresponding to the target location information included in the user instruction information is not the current scene, the state information of the target intelligent household appliance may be called from the target intelligent gateway in the target scene corresponding to the target location information. The state information of the target smart home device may be used to indicate the current operating state of the target smart home device.
In some embodiments, the gateway device may further obtain the operating states of the smart devices in all the scenarios from the server by connecting to the server.
Step S208: and determining whether the target intelligent household appliance performs the operation corresponding to the control information or not according to the state information.
As a specific implementation scenario, for example, when the intelligent gateway K1 in the room a collects a user instruction "close the wall air conditioner B1 in the room B", the intelligent gateway K1 may request the intelligent gateway K2 in the room B to acquire state information of the wall air conditioner B1 in the room B, and if the state information indicates that the current working state of the wall air conditioner B1 is running, it is determined that the current target intelligent household appliance does not execute the operation corresponding to the control information; if the state information indicates that the current working state of the wall-mounted air conditioner B1 is off, it is determined that the current target intelligent household appliance has performed the operation corresponding to the control information.
In this embodiment, when the target intelligent home appliance does not perform the operation corresponding to the control information, step S209 may be performed.
Step S209: and sending the control information to a target intelligent gateway with the position matched with the target position information.
In this embodiment, when the target intelligent household electrical appliance does not execute the operation corresponding to the control information, the current intelligent gateway may send the control information to the target intelligent gateway of the target scene, so that the target intelligent gateway controls the target intelligent household electrical appliance to execute the operation corresponding to the control information according to the control information.
In this embodiment, when the target intelligent home device has performed the operation corresponding to the control information, step S210 and/or step S211 may be executed to notify the user that the target intelligent home device has entered the working state expected by the user in a preset manner.
Step S210: and displaying a prompt image on a display screen of the current intelligent gateway.
In this embodiment, the prompt image is used to notify the user that the target smart home device has entered the working state expected by the user. As one mode, the prompt image may be displayed on the display screen of the intelligent gateway in a natural language text mode, or may be displayed on the display screen in a graphic mode, a mark mode, or the like, so as to realize the function of notifying the user.
Step S211: and playing prompt voice through a loudspeaker of the current intelligent gateway.
In this embodiment, the prompt voice is used to notify the user that the target smart home device has entered the working state expected by the user. As one mode, the prompt voice may be played through a speaker of the smart gateway in a natural language voice mode, or may be notified to the user in a non-natural language audio mode such as an alarm or a prompt tone.
In some embodiments, the intelligent gateway may select a corresponding information feedback manner according to a manner in which the user triggers the user instruction information. For example, when a user issues a user instruction through physical key or touch screen operation, the intelligent gateway can feed back the instruction of the user by displaying a prompt image on the display screen; when the user gives the user instruction in a voice mode, the intelligent gateway can feed back the instruction in a voice playing prompting mode.
In some embodiments, the information feedback of the intelligent gateway can also be performed by displaying the prompt image and playing the prompt voice at the same time.
According to the intelligent home control method provided by the embodiment, user instruction information can be further acquired through key detection or voice recognition and other modes, and information feedback can be performed with a user according to the working state of the target intelligent home appliance, so that the implementation of the scheme is more flexible and intelligent, the scheme can be applied to different practical situations, and the interaction of the intelligent home and the operation experience of the user are further improved.
